Replica Fourier Transforms on Ultrametric Trees, and Block-Diagonalizing Multi-Replica Matrices
The analysis of objects living on ultrametric trees, in particular the
block-diagonalization of 4-replica matrices ,
is shown to be dramatically simplified through the introduction of properly
chosen operations on those objects. These are the Replica Fourier Transforms on
ultrametric trees. Those transformations are defined and used in the present
work.Comment: Latex file, 14 page
Perturbative QCD factorization of and
We prove factorization theorem for the processes and
to leading twist in the covariant gauge by means of the
Ward identity. Soft divergences cancel and collinear divergences are grouped
into a pion wave function defined by a nonlocal matrix element. The gauge
invariance and universality of the pion wave function are confirmed. The proof
is then extended to the exclusive meson decays and
in the heavy quark limit. It is shown that a light-cone
meson wave function, though absorbing soft dynamics, can be defined in an
appropriate frame. Factorization of the decay in
space, being parton transverse momenta, is briefly discussed. We comment
on the extraction of the leading-twist pion wave function from experimental
data.Comment: 21 pages in Latex file, version to appear in Phys. Rev.
